On the mechanism for the generation of a vortex electric field in the ionospheric E-region

Description
A mechanism is proposed for the generation of a vortex electric field in the ionospheric E-region. It is shown that long-scale (with a wavelength of L > 103 km) synoptically short-period (from several minutes to several hours) fast (with a propagation velocity higher than 1 km/s) processes excite a vortex electric field that may be much higher than the dynamo field generated in this region by ionospheric winds
